Output a84f995fe5d6c272010fc72589113de663751e7b1027141638aa6f3e88b7683f:18

value
303800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4dc677e3cfab2fb56f0aaa1d11b44b20168da12 OP_EQUAL
address
3NZ82EmhBoPKmTxGiMQ9fydirXbcoMFuCt
transaction
a84f995fe5d6c272010fc72589113de663751e7b1027141638aa6f3e88b7683f
confirmations
272701
spent
true